概括
可持续的聚3-基酸-co-3-基酸) (PHBV) 和pullulan (PUL) 纤维丝与氨酸被开发用于骨再生支架. 普卢兰增强了烯释放和改善了支架特性,显示了生物相容性.

背景情况:
- 聚3-基酸-co-3-基酸 (PHBV) 是一种生物降解的聚合物,具有骨再生的潜力.
- 从脚手架上控制药物释放对于有效的治疗治疗至关重要.
- 普鲁兰 (PUL) 是一种天然的多糖,可以改变聚合物的特性.
研究的目的:
- 为了研究pullulan对PHBV含有烯酸的纤维的特性的影响,用于脚手架应用.
- 评估PUL/PHBV混合物的热,形态和生物行为.
- 为了评估基托从发育的细丝中的体外释放动力学.
主要方法:
- 制备的聚3-基酸-co-3-基酸) (PHBV) 和普鲁兰 (PUL) /PHBV的纤维丝,其中包括基.
- 使用汉森参数,差分扫描热量计 (DSC) 和扫描电子显微镜 (SEM) 的表征.
- 在骨质细胞的体外细胞毒性测试和烯溶解研究.
主要成果:
- 汉森参数表明混合物中聚合物和药物的可变性发生变化,导致热稳定和结晶性降低.
- SEM图像显示,烯光滑和均化了灯丝表面.
- 细胞毒性测试证实了所有样本的生物相容性. 普鲁兰在240分钟内从0.1%增加到36%的累积烯释放量.
结论:
- 聚烯/PHBV混合物表现出可调节的热和形态特性.
- 开发的纤维是生物相容的,适合用于骨再生支架.
- 普鲁兰在控制甲释放动力学方面发挥着关键作用,为改善治疗结果提供了潜在的潜力.

Actin Filament Depolymerization
3.0K
Actin filaments (F-actin) are composed of actin subunits. The dissociation of actin monomers can occur from either end of F-actin. The rate of dissociation is faster from the minus-end or the pointed end, where the actin subunits exist with a bound ADP, together known as ADP-actin. The depolymerization of F-actin is aided by proteins, including the actin-depolymerizing factor (ADF) and cofilin family of proteins, gelsolin, and glia maturation factor (GMF).

Factors Affecting Dissolution: Drug pKa, Lipophilicity and GI pH
1.0K
Drug absorption within the gastrointestinal (GI) tract is a complex process influenced by several critical factors, including the site pH, the drug's dissociation constant (pKa), and the drug's lipophilicity. The GI tract exhibits a pH gradient, with an acidic environment in the stomach and a more alkaline environment in the small intestine. This pH variation directly affects the ionization state of drugs.
